I am planning to buy an all-in-one phone with various features at a reasonable price, and i was considering a k750i.

However, it's been over 1,5 years since its first release, and both Nokia and SE are anouncing new models with similar & superior specifications - Now, i would ask your forgiveness because of the question you people probably encountered a thousand times, but, would i choose k750 or some other available model, or wait for a few weeks for an upcoming one?

I know that k750 has autofocus with better photo quality than most others on its price range, and has enough audio playing capabilities for me so i don't wanna sacrifice camera performance for more Walkman abilities. And i probably can not afford a model over %20 more expensive than k750 I plan to use this new phone for around two years, so what do you guys suppose i should do? Do you think the k750 has aged terribly, or will have soon after some new stuff comes up this chrismas or so?

W800 is a close contestant, but i just don't like the looks of it at all! You know, i would opt for the classic "blackish, formal-looking" design.

I'd say the K750i is still an excellent phone, and buying it now makes good sense, as newer models will have pushed the K750i's price right down. The camera quality is excellent, and is, as you say, a brilliant all round phone.

If you could live with the styling, the W800i would be a slightly better bet, as it has an identical camera module, plus the better Walkman player for only a small amount now of money more. Or you could get a W800i, and fit it was a K750i facia/housing!

Here in Turkiye, K750i is sold for 340+ USD, Whereas W800 goes for more than 490 US dollars. Too big a gap for me to leap over, considering the small benefits of purchasing the latter. There's also W810 with a price similar to that of W800 (470 USD), and apparently has some pros to it. And there's some W700 with no visible difference in specs with W800, but has a price tag of 310+USD?!

the w700i doesn't have auto-focus and comes with a 256 mb card while the w800i comes with a 512 mb card. w700i has a terrible camera.

btw i think you should go for the k750i (64mb card), if you have more cash than definitely get the w800i or the w810i.

the k750i at the moment can rival all the big phones atm.
-has good cam
-good design
-excellent mp3 player
-torch
etc
